摘要:为了优化盐酸浸提-AAS法的检测条件,在植物颗粒不同粒径、振荡时间、浸提温度、浸提方式及不同盐酸浓度浸提条件下,以盐酸浸提法测定钾、钙、镁含量。结果表明:盐酸浸提法适宜采用过60目筛的植物颗粒,以室温盐酸浸提,适宜振荡时间为90 min。以热盐酸浸提,适宜采用55℃热盐酸振荡60 min,盐酸适宜浓度为1 mol/L,盐酸浸提样品的适宜方式为振荡。试验提出的盐酸浸提-AAS方法准确高效,经济安全,操作方便,适用于批量样品的检测分析。
To optimize the detection conditions, hydrochloric acid extraction-AAS method was used to determine the content of potassium, calcium and magnesium under different conditions, such as different particle size, oscillation time, temperature, extraction methods and concentrations of hydrochloric acid. The results showed that sieving 60 mesh plant particles were suitable for hydrochloric acid leaching method,suitable oscillation time was 90 min with hydrochloric acid soaking at room temperature. With hot hydrochloric acid soaking, the temperature of hydrochloric acid was 55℃ and suitable oscillation time was 60 min. Proper concentration of hydrochloric acid was 1 mol/L. The proper method of hydrochloric acid leaching sample was oscillation. Hydrochloric acid extraction-AAS method established in this experiment was accurate and efficient, economic and security, easy operation, it was suitable for inspection of batch sample.
